From e4a1c9311dfca3c6e798f03e1b6ae43879834f52 Mon Sep 17 00:00:00 2001 From: Vincent Siveton Date: Sat, 30 Aug 2008 13:39:27 +0000 Subject: [PATCH] o be sure that deprecated tag for parameter is not empty git-svn-id: https://svn.apache.org/repos/asf/maven/plugin-tools/trunk@690503 13f79535-47bb-0310-9956-ffa450edef68 --- .../plugin/generator/PluginDescriptorGenerator.java | 9 ++++++++- 1 file changed, 8 insertions(+), 1 deletion(-) diff --git a/maven-plugin-tools-api/src/main/java/org/apache/maven/tools/plugin/generator/PluginDescriptorGenerator.java b/maven-plugin-tools-api/src/main/java/org/apache/maven/tools/plugin/generator/PluginDescriptorGenerator.java index 6b299f6..a3f5634 100644 --- a/maven-plugin-tools-api/src/main/java/org/apache/maven/tools/plugin/generator/PluginDescriptorGenerator.java +++ b/maven-plugin-tools-api/src/main/java/org/apache/maven/tools/plugin/generator/PluginDescriptorGenerator.java @@ -351,7 +351,14 @@ public class PluginDescriptorGenerator if ( parameter.getDeprecated() != null ) { - PluginUtils.element( w, "deprecated", parameter.getDeprecated() ); + if ( StringUtils.isEmpty( parameter.getDeprecated() ) ) + { + PluginUtils.element( w, "deprecated", "No reason given" ); + } + else + { + PluginUtils.element( w, "deprecated", parameter.getDeprecated() ); + } } if ( parameter.getImplementation() != null )